Nelson has approximately 750 parking stalls that are serviced by either a meter or a PayStation (kiosk). Paid parking is in effect from Monday through Saturday, 9 a.m. to 5 p.m.
Parking is not permitted for more than 72 hours continuously.
Nelson has one parkade located in the downtown core on the 400 block of Vernon Street.
Motorists parking for parking longer than 2 hours are encouraged to utilize the parkade. Day parking (8 hours) at a metered stall costs $10, whereas the daily rate in the parkade is $8.

Vehicles are permitted to use a loading zone for up to three minutes for the loading and unloading of passengers, or up to 10 minutes for goods. A valid commercial vehicle licence decal is required to use a commercial loading zone.
Whenever access can be had to any laneway, all deliveries or collections of goods to or from any commercial building shall be made there from.
No parking is permitted in a laneway except for the loading or unloading of goods from a vehicle, in which case parking is permitted for up to 15 minutes.
Street parking is regulated by the Traffic Bylaw. Please reference it for any further information you require.
Off-street parking is regulated by the Off-Street Parking and Landscape Bylaw.
